Note: The job is a remote job and is open to candidates in USA. StackAdapt is the leading technology company that empowers marketers to reach, engage, and convert audiences with precision. The Senior Product Manager will own the roadmap for Measurement solutions and create new solutions, ensuring high-quality delivery and customer engagement.
Responsibilities
- Owning and creating the roadmap for various existing Measurement solutions (Foot Traffic Attribution, Account-Based Marketing Measurement, First-Party Data Attribution, etc.)
- Creating 0->1 Measurement solutions across new verticals and customer journeys
- Responsible for delivery of product specs that capture user needs along with clear direction for the engineer, design, and QA team on how the feature should behave and what success looks like
- Success for this role is someone who can drive features through to completion, delivering high-quality results while dealing with ambiguity, and creating products that drive more customer engagement with the StackAdapt platform
Skills
- Proven experience delivering complex projects across multiple milestones
- Excellent collaborator, able to tailor your approach when working with Product, Design, Engineering, Data Science, and Revenue teams
- Keen design sense; you're able to look at a feature and understand it through a user's eyes
- Clarity of writing denotes clarity of thought; you're able to capture and distill ideas down into written word in order to build consensus around your vision
- You've successfully incorporated LLM usage into your day-to-day to accelerate your work, and understand where these tools can help customers versus where more deterministic methods are appropriate
- AdTech experience preferred but not required
